[20250208]library cache mutex X与library cache bucket mutex X的区别(21c).txt --//以前在学习参考文档里面:链接https://tanelpoder.com/files/Oracle_Latch_And_Mutex_Contention_Troubleshooting.pdf --//P17页,如下内容: PARAMETER1 - idn: . cursor:* wait events . idn = hash value of the library cache object under protection . library cache: mutex* wait events 1) library cache hash bucket number (if idn <= 131072) 2) idn = hash value of the library cache object under protection (if idn > 131072) --//似乎idn<131072,library cache hash bucket number.idn > 131072,hash value of the library cache object under --//protection有点武断,有可能sql语句的hash_value有可能小于131072,这篇pdf文档建立日期非常早2009年,我记忆里当时看了几个 --//生产库,没有找到sql语句的hash_value小于131072的情况,可以猜测出现idn <= 131072,大部分原因是library cache hash bucket --//number 的可能性还是很大. --//hash_value最大0xffffffff = 4294967295, 131072/4294967295 = .00003051757813210542,相当于10万里面有3个,概率还是不大。 --//自已一段时间没事做这方面测试,首先要找到一个sql语句hash_value<131072,正好最近一段时间有空,尝试看看。 --//library cache mutex X与library cache bucket mutex X的区别,两者有点混淆,做1个测试说明细节。 1.环境: SCOTT@book01p> @ ver2 ============================== PORT_STRING : x86_64/Linux 2.4.xx VERSION : 21.0.0.0.0 BANNER : Oracle Database 21c Enterprise Edition Release 21.0.0.0.0 - Production BANNER_FULL : Oracle Database 21c Enterprise Edition Release 21.0.0.0.0 - Production Version 21.3.0.0.0 BANNER_LEGACY : Oracle Database 21c Enterprise Edition Release 21.0.0.0.0 - Production CON_ID : 0 PL/SQL procedure successfully completed. 2.测试前准备: --//首先要找到一个sql语句hash_value<131072。 $ cat m9.txt DECLARE l_count PLS_INTEGER; BEGIN FOR i IN 1..&&1 LOOP EXECUTE IMMEDIATE 'select /*+ &&2 */ count(*) from dept where deptno = '||i INTO l_count ; END LOOP; END; / --//注:没有使用绑定变量. $ seq 10 | xargs -IQ sqlplus -s -l scott/book@book01p @ m9.txt 1e5 Q > /dev/null --//注意不能并发执行,不然即使出现也很快从共享池清理出去。 select * from (select sql_text,hash_value from v$sql where hash_value<131072 ) order by 2 ; select sql_text,hash_value from v$sql order by 2; --//而且要一边执行m9.txt脚本,一边执行以上sql语句。 --//找到2条: select /*+ 2 */ count(*) from dept where deptno = 41554; selecT /*+ 1 */ count(*) from dept where deptno = 49094; SCOTT@book01p> select /*+ 2 */ count(*) from dept where deptno = 41554; COUNT(*) ---------- 0 SCOTT@book01p> @ hashz HASH_VALUE SQL_ID CHILD_NUMBER KGL_BUCKET HASH_HEX SQL_EXEC_START SQL_EXEC_ID ---------- ------------- ------------ ---------- ---------- ------------------- ----------- 37807 7rc8r200014xg 0 37807 93af 2025-02-08 16:03:53 16777216 --//HASH_VALUE=KGL_BUCKET=37807 --//建立测试脚本如下: $ cat ma.txt alter session set session_cached_cursors=0; DECLARE v_pad VARCHAR2 (200); l_count PLS_INTEGER; BEGIN FOR i IN 1..&&1 LOOP EXECUTE IMMEDIATE 'select /*+ 2 */ count(*) from dept where deptno = 41554' INTO l_count; END LOOP; END; / --//设置session_cached_cursors=0;,这样每次执行都是软解析。 3.测试: --//测试前刷新共享池,alter system flush shared_pool;因为前面执行的语句与脚本执行语句的游标不共享。 $ zzdate;seq 10 | xargs -P 10 -IQ sqlplus -s -l scott/book@book01p --//P1对应就是idn,21c估计做了改进拆分出来了library cache: bucket mutex X等待事情,在11g重复做1次,好像11g没有library --//cache: bucket mutex X。 --//如果无法区分看P3RAW,前面8位我估计对应的就是sql语句的hash值,后面值转换位10进制 0x55=85 , 0x6a=106 , 0x39 = 57 ,0x3e= 62 --//补充说明在11g下P3RAW前面8位全部是00000000 --//在这样的情况下library cache: mutex X,library cache: bucket mutex X成为主要等待事件。 SYS@book> @ mutexprofz idn,hash,val,loc,maddr
